Improved Safety Measures:
Rideshare providers have a duty to ensure the security of their drivers and passengers. They should continually assess and update safety protocols to combat sexual assault and violence. Some key precautionary steps include:
a) Rigorous background checks: In-depth background checks should be performed on those providing the rides to identify any prior criminal history or red flags.
b) Driver and passenger verification: Employing robust methods, such as verifying users' IDs through verification or unique biometrics, can help lower the risk of unauthorized access to the platform.
c) In-app safety features: Both Uber and Lyft have implemented safety features, such as emergency buttons, real-time tracking, and mutual rating systems, to ensure accountability and enable swift responses to potential incidents.

Active Law Enforcement Involvement:
Law enforcement agencies play a critical part in addressing assault and violence within the ride-hailing industry. They should collaborate closely with ridesharing companies to establish effective strategies to tackle and respond to such crimes. Some key steps for law enforcement authorities include:
a) Improved reporting mechanisms: Establishing streamlined channels for reporting and ensuring privacy for victims can promote more reporting and facilitate enforcement efforts.
b) Partnerships and information exchange: Sharing relevant information between police and ridesharing providers can assist in detecting repeat offenders and strengthening preventive measures.
c) Training and education: Conducting training sessions for law enforcement personnel to better understand the specificities of assault and violence in the ride-hailing industry can improve their capacity to respond effectively.
